Leveling Kit Options?

I have a 2005 CC F250 6.0L diesel that I want to install a leveling kit on as well as 35x12.5x20's. I asked this question in the diesel forum and got next to nothing in terms of a response. Maybe I asked the question in the wrong forum. At any rate, is any leveling kit better than any other leveling kit? Isn't a spacer a spacer? I have seen people charging quite different prices for what looks to be almost the same spacers. I am also planning on installing Bilstien shocks at the same time. Let me know what you've had good luck with (or not so good luck). Thanks!

IMO Readylift probably sells one of the better leveling kits. Their not cheap but well made and fit well.

Remember their not designed for off-road use so you may want to go with full spring leveling kit if that is your intent.

I think the "top hat" type steel spacers that install above the spring and sit in the upper spring cone mount are a more solid and safe design compared to the lower spring spacers. I bought mine from top-gun customz 2.5" 05-07 Ford F250/F350 Super Duty Leveling Lift Kit @Top Gun Customz and then fab my own 3/8 poly dampner spacers. I didn't purchase the Readylift because i didn't want the shock extenders. I did purchase RL's track bar bracket kit though which is a quality well made kit.

Originally Posted by DAVE67FD
I think the "top hat" type steel spacers that install above the spring and sit in the upper spring cone mount are a more solid and safe design compared to the lower spring spacers.
Yeah, because those lower perches are only held on with a 14mm class 10.9 bolt, those are such wimpy pieces of metal with only a measly 120,000 psi proof load. I can't imagine how something so flimsy could ever compare to a part that even isn't bolted on at all.....

BDS makes 1" and 2" kits, comes with alignment cams, and you can get their crappy shocks or not. But replacement 2" springs are relatively cheap, and are really the better way to go. There are a few brands where you can pick up just the springs, and patch together your own kit with the brands of shocks and junk you prefer.
